How progress indicators influence determination and endurance
Development signals transform conceptual waiting periods into tangible sight-based experiences that sustain visitor determination. A processing indicator communicates both current condition and outstanding duration, permitting visitors to make educated choices about persisting or abandoning activities. Observable development produces cognitive momentum that encourages task completion.
The objective-proximity impact explains why users speed up efforts as advancement indicators near conclusion. Visual proximity to destinations initiates heightened involvement and patience. A development indicator at 80% seems considerably tighter to finishing than one at 20%, even when total duration leftover stays unchanged.
Partitioned development visualizations decrease observed work by dividing large jobs into lesser checkpoints. A five-step procedure with finished steps marked feels more manageable than a solitary continuous indicator. Psychological pacing in user experiences
Affective pacing coordinates the cadence of anticipation and discharge during visitor experiences. Developers control magnitude changes by switching between intense points and recovery intervals. A well-timed path prevents affective fatigue while maintaining enough stimulation to maintain curiosity.
Setup processes demonstrate successful emotional pacing through incremental complexity presentation. Initial displays show straightforward activities that create assurance through quick victories. Later steps introduce complex features progressively, permitting users to expect mastery without sensing swamped.
Purchase processes need thoughtful rhythm to sustain purchase momentum while handling necessary friction spots. Expectation builds as customers move toward purchase completion, but too many phases drain eagerness.
